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Hartford (Cheshire) to Montpelier start from as little as £22.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Hartford (Cheshire) to Montpelier are available for £53.00 one way, or £88.80 return

Station Facilities: Start Your Journey Right

At Hartford station, ticket purchase is straightforward, with a ticket office open Monday through Sunday, accommodating early birds and late shoppers alike. Weekdays see the ticket office opening as early as 6:00 AM. While online ticket collection is simplified with available machines, accessibility can be an issue as these machines aren't adapted for users with disabilities. Don't worry, for staff assistance is on-hand during ticket office hours, ready to help you navigate your journey with ease.

Facilities at the station provide the essentials. Although the station lacks amenities like shops or refreshment facilities, there are seating areas, and toilets available during ticket office hours, ensuring basic comfort while you wait. Accessibility services are geared towards ensuring passengers can travel confidently, with step-free access to platforms facilitated by ramps, and assistance available via hard-working staff noted for their diligence and readiness to help at customer help points around the station.

Getting to and From the Station with Ease

Hartford station is well connected with local transport links, making your arrival and departure seamless. For times when rail replacement is necessary, services run from designated bus stops adjacent to the station car park. Local taxi services offer various options, including Station Taxis and Redcab, ensuring you can always find convenient onward travel.

For those who prefer cycling, Hartford station offers bicycle storage though without shelters, and if you’re opting for a drive, parking is ample with 77 spaces, including 3 accessible spots. A reminder, parking payments can be made via the Saba Parking UK app or at pay machines onsite.

Facilities for a Seamless Journey

While Montpelier station does not boast a ticket office, you can easily buy and collect tickets from the available ticket machines. If you require additional support, the station features accessible machines and an induction loop to ensure a seamless experience for everyone. Although there are no waiting rooms or 1st class lounges, there is some comfortable seating to ease your wait.

For those thinking about security, rest assured, the station is equipped with CCTV. However, note that facilities like a refreshment area, ATMs, or baby-changing stations are not available, so plan accordingly. If cycling is your preferred mode of transport to and from the station, it offers some bicycle racks for storage, although they aren't sheltered.

Getting Around with Ease

Montpelier offers step-free access across the station, supporting passengers with mobility challenges. While staff help is not explicitly available, assistance for those who need it can be requested up to 2 hours before their journey begins with the Passenger Assist service. Need additional travel information? Don’t hesitate to reach out to GWR Help & Support or their social media team.

Transportation Links from Montpelier

Moving beyond the trains, Montpelier station has bus stops conveniently located along Cheltenham Road, making it easier to connect to various parts of the city. While taxi services aren’t available directly at the station, accessible set-down and pick-up points for mobility-impaired passengers ensure hassle-free transit. Up for a little more activity? Bicycles are a viable option with hire availability indicated, making intermodal journeys straightforward. For comprehensive onward journey details, check the printable travel information here.
